Renzo Gracie Student,Dave Branch, Signs with UFC
By: Reverend Turk Vangel Posted On: May 24, 2010 at 9:30amTwo-time Bellator Fighting Championships fighter and Renzo Gracie (13-7-1) student Dave Branch (6-0) has signed a four-fight deal with the Ultimate Fighting Championships (UFC).
Renzo Gracie announced the news about his black belt student making his way into the UFC.
Branch is an exciting fighter who turned pro in 2007 and since then has a record of 6-0 all coming via stoppage. Three were technical knock out (TKO) victories and the other three were submission wins.
It is rare to see a jiu jitsu black belt who also possesses good striking and knock out power so early on in his MMA career. This makes Branch a unique prospect who could end up making some big waves in the UFC considering their ability and willingness to bring a fighter along slowly.
